1. Navigating the Basics of UTM NetworkingUnified Threat Management (UTM) networks, simply put, combine multiple security features into a single appliance. These security features may include a firewall, antivirus software, intrusion detection and prevention systems, and spam filtering, among others. They offer the advantages of simplified management and reduced costs, because organizations can manage multiple security functions from a single console rather than dealing with a complex array of separate security devices.UTM devices are popular in small and medium-sized businesses because they offer robust security at an affordable cost. However, they also have limitations, such as possible performance bottlenecks and challenges with complex networks. Hence, the decision to adopt UTM networking should be made based on an organization's unique needs and network complexity.2. The Strengths of UTM NetworkingUTM networking comes with several strengths that set it apart from traditional standalone security solutions. These include:A. Simplified ManagementWith UTM, organizations can manage a variety of security features from a single console, saving time and resources.B. Comprehensive CoverageUTM offers a wide range of security features, ensuring a more comprehensive coverage against threats compared to standalone solutions.C. Cost EffectivenessInstead of purchasing multiple individual security appliances, businesses can invest in a single UTM device, saving on both initial and operational costs.3. The Challenges in UTM NetworkingDespite its numerous benefits, UTM networking is not without its challenges. These include:A. Performance BottlenecksAs a single device handles multiple security functions, there's a possibility of performance bottlenecks, especially in larger, data-intensive organizations.B. Lack of SpecializationWhile UTM offers a range of features, it might not have the same depth or specialization as standalone security products that focus on a single area.C. Complex Network CompatibilityUTM networking might be challenging to deploy in complex networks, as its "one size fits all" approach may not suit every unique configuration or security requirement.4.
